Client Support: Supporting the Extension Workforce:

The Extension professional is notoriously overextended and on the move. The technologies that they rely upon have to be usable, flexible, durable, reliable, maintainable and secure. Meeting the needs of this workforce requires solutions that are often innovative yet proven and dependable. Most of all, though, these solutions must be supportable.
Example Topics:
  • Client Backups
  • Productivity Solutions
  • Client Systems Management
  • Anti Virus and Anti Malware
  • Image and Deployment Solutions
  • Support Programs
  • Helpdesk

Systems & Infrastructure: Enabling Service Delivery

The availability, durability, and extensibility of the technologies that underpin and facilitate our client-facing services are critical to our parent organizations' ability to deliver programs and maintain operations. The mission-critical nature of enabling services such as network connectivity, database management systems, web content management systems inherently place elevated demands upon the IT support structure. How do we practically manage these "enabling" services to reduce the risk of failure or interruption? What are cost effective alternatives to building and supporting an in-house infrastructure? What are the relevant technological and resource trends?
Example Topics:
  • Information Security
  • Virtualization
  • Backup & Disaster Recovery
  • Networking
  • Cloud Hosting
  • Storage Solutions
  • Systems Management

IT Management: Leading People & Leveraging Resources

Technologies, operating environments, and programmatic requirements are in constant flux. IT managers often struggle to identify and implement appropriate tools and techniques for managing their support organizations and to align resources to institutional needs. How does one accurately identify the true information technology needs of the organization? What can be done to recruit, train, retain and inspire quality employees? In what ways can the IT support operation demonstrate and communicate its true value to the parent organization?
Example Topics:
  • Information Technology Service Management
  • Budget Management
  • Employee Development
  • Resource Management
  • Recruiting and Retaining Talent
  • Communications Strategies
  • Vendor Relations
  • Insourcing and Outsourcing
  • Program, Portfolio, and Project Mangement
  • Decision Support
